Quick Brief

The Department of Veterans Affairs is procuring environmental compliance support services for the Greater Los Angeles VA Healthcare System. The contractor will provide air quality support and manage hazardous waste reporting requirements across multiple locations. Key requirements include completing the overdue 2025 Biennial Hazardous Waste Report.

Description

The purpose of this amendment is the following: To respond to inquiries from vendors seeking information and clarification for RFQ 36C26226Q0985 (See answers to inquiries below in this amendment). To extend the offer due date/time to No Later Than July 06, 2026, at 02:00 PM Pacific Standard Time (PST). Contractor Inquiries- Environmental Compliance Support Services for GLA Is Biennial Hazardous Waste Reporting required for the odd reporting year, 2027? Can you please clarify the requirement for the Biennial Hazardous Waste Reporting during this

period of performance? The

Scope of Work states to complete the Biennial Hazardous Waste Reporting for multiple locations. Biennial hazardous waste reporting is required on even reporting years, which means the reporting is next due in 2028. The
